Specifications
Frequency Stability: ±50ppm
Height: 0.031" (0.79mm)
Size / Dimension: 0.197" L x 0.126" W (5.00mm x 3.20mm)
Package / Case: 6-SMD, No Lead
Mounting Type: Surface Mount
Ratings: --
Current - Supply (Max): 51mA
Spread Spectrum Bandwidth: ±0.25%, Center Spread
Operating Temperature: -40°C ~ 85°C
Frequency Stability (Total): --
Series: SiT9002
Voltage - Supply: 2.5V
Output: CML
Function: --
Available Frequency Range: 1MHz ~ 220MHz
Programmable Type: Programmed by Digi-Key (Enter your frequency in Web Order Notes)
Type: XO (Standard)
Base Resonator: MEMS
Part Status: Active
Packaging: Bulk
